Petra Pichler is a scholar working on Genetics, Pathology and Forensic Medicine and Pharmacology. According to data from OpenAlex, Petra Pichler has authored 22 papers receiving a total of 286 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Genetics, 7 papers in Pathology and Forensic Medicine and 6 papers in Pharmacology. Recurrent topics in Petra Pichler's work include Lymphoma Diagnosis and Treatment (7 papers), Chronic Lymphocytic Leukemia Research (6 papers) and Antibiotics Pharmacokinetics and Efficacy (6 papers). Petra Pichler is often cited by papers focused on Lymphoma Diagnosis and Treatment (7 papers), Chronic Lymphocytic Leukemia Research (6 papers) and Antibiotics Pharmacokinetics and Efficacy (6 papers). Petra Pichler collaborates with scholars based in Austria, Germany and Belgium. Petra Pichler's co-authors include Walter Oberhuber, Wolfgang Poeppl, Markus Zeitlinger, Martin Wiesholzer, Manuel Kussmann, Gottfried Reznicek, Heinz Burgmann, Gertraud Heinz‐Peer, Sebastian Brandner and Andreas Stadlbauer and has published in prestigious journals such as Journal of Clinical Oncology, Blood and Cancer Research.
